Conversion formula

The conversion factor from cubic feet to cubic meters is 0.0283168467117, which means that 1 cubic foot is equal to 0.0283168467117 cubic meters:

1 ft3 = 0.0283168467117 m3

To convert 3740 cubic feet into cubic meters we have to multiply 3740 by the conversion factor in order to get the volume amount from cubic feet to cubic meters. We can also form a simple proportion to calculate the result:

1 ft3 → 0.0283168467117 m3

3740 ft3 → V(m3)

Solve the above proportion to obtain the volume V in cubic meters:

V(m3) = 3740 ft3 × 0.0283168467117 m3

V(m3) = 105.90500670176 m3

The final result is:

3740 ft3 → 105.90500670176 m3

We conclude that 3740 cubic feet is equivalent to 105.90500670176 cubic meters:

3740 cubic feet = 105.90500670176 cubic meters
